Stability of a Fusarium solani pisi recombinant cutinase in phosphatidylcholine reversed micelles
Authors:A M Pinto-Sousa  J M S Cabral and M R Aires-Barros
Institution:(1) Laboratório de Engenharia Bioquímica, Instituto Superior Técnico, Centro de Engenharia Biológica e Química, 1000 Lisboa, Portugal
Abstract:Summary A Fusarium solani pisi recombinant cutinase solubilized in phosphatidylcholine/isooctane reversed micelles was used to catalyse the esterification reaction of butyric acid with 2-butanol at pH 10.7. The influence of temperature, Wo and substrates on lipase stability was evaluated. The enzyme displays a better stability, with a half-life over 125 days, at a temperature of 22°C and for a low water content (WO= 6.5). Butyric acid increased the cutinase deactivation (t1/2=0.56h), while 2-butanol led to a similar half-life (t1/2=14h) as without substrate.
